Description

Function to generate an htmlwidget with a voronoi treemap

vt_d3(data, elementId = NULL, width = NULL, height = NULL,
  seed = NULL, title = NULL, legend = FALSE, legend_title = NULL,
  footer = NULL, label = TRUE, color_circle = "#aaaaaa",
  color_border = "#ffffff", color_label = "#000000",
  size_border = "1px", size_border_hover = "3px",
  size_circle = "2px")

Arguments

data

a correct json data object

elementId

optional a custom elementId to be returned

width

width of the widget

height

height of the widget

seed

if defined, the plot is fixed

title

NULL or a string for the title

legend

TRUE/FALSE if a legend should be printed

legend_title

NULL or a string for the title of the legend

footer

NULL or a string for the footer text

label

TRUE/FALSE if the labels should be printed

color_circle

color for the outer circle

color_border

color for the inner lines

color_label

color for the label in the plot

size_border

thickness of the borders in css style, e.g. '1px'

size_border_hover

thickness of the borders when hovering in css style, e.g. '3px'

size_circle

thickness of the circle in css style, e.g. '2px'

Note

The JavaScript library d3-voronoi treemap can be found here https://github.com/Kcnarf/d3-voronoi-treemap and the example is based on the remake of HowMuch.net's article 'The Global Economy by GDP' by _Kcnarf https://bl.ocks.org/Kcnarf/fa95aa7b076f537c00aed614c29bb568.

References

Arlind Nocaj and Ulrik Brandes. (2012). Computing Voronoi Treempas: Faster, Simpler and Resolution-independent. Computer Graphics Forum. Vol.31. 855-864.

vt_d3(vt_export_json(vt_testdata()))
data(ExampleGDP)
gdp_json <- vt_export_json(vt_input_from_df(ExampleGDP))
vt_d3(gdp_json)
data(canada)
canada$codes <- canada$h3
canada <- canada[canada$h1=="Canada",]
canadaH <- vt_input_from_df(canada,scaleToPerc = FALSE)
vt_d3(vt_export_json(canadaH))
#without label
vt_d3(vt_export_json(canadaH), label=FALSE)
#Example with coloring from scales package
library(scales)
canada$color <- seq_gradient_pal()(exp(canada$weight)/500)
canadaH <- vt_input_from_df(canada,scaleToPerc = FALSE)
vt_d3(vt_export_json(canadaH))
